A STUDY ON PERSONALITY OF PRIMARY SCHOOL TEACHERS WITH REFERENCE TO THEIR JOB SATISFACTION IN TIRUVALLUR DISTRICT

D.SUBASH, P.KARNAN

Abstract

This study examined the relationship between personality of the Primary school Teacher’s with reference to their job satisfaction. This study adopted survey method of research participants were 300 primary school Teacher’s randomly selected from different schools Tiruvallur District. Research Instruments used for data collection was personality inventory developed by Hens Eysenck and Job satisfaction Inventory developed by S.Sathiyagirirajan tested at 0.05 and 0.01 level of significance. The result reveals that the personality of primary school teacher’s with reference to their job satisfaction moderate in nature. The findings indicated that there is a positive relationship among personality and job satisfaction of the primary school Teacher’s. There exist significant impact with respect to type of management, Teacher’s experience and also there is no significant impact with respect to Gender, Location, Marital status, Teacher’s Qualifications, Subject Group on personality and job satisfaction of Primary school Teacher’s.
